Dianthus likes the sunDianthus is a typical sun-loving plant that prefers a warm, humid, well-lit growing environment. Only in an environment with sufficient light can the plant grow better, but it cannot be completely deprived of light nor exposed to direct sunlight. If it is necessary to bask in the sun in the summer, it is best to do so in the morning or evening. Dianthus basking in the sunThe more light a plant like Dianthus gets, the better it will grow. When caring for it, you need to place it in a well-lit location and let the plant get more sun, but it should not be exposed to strong sunlight, otherwise the plant will become dry and yellow. Dianthus LightDianthus flowers like light and have relatively high requirements for light. The daily light time should not be less than 6 hours, so that the plant can grow and bloom normally. If it is a newly planted dianthus, you need to wait until it has finished acclimatizing before giving it light. What to do if dianthus wilts in the sunThe wilt of dianthus may be caused by excessive light. This plant is afraid of strong sunlight. If it is found to be sunburned, it is necessary to cut off the injured part in time, and then place it in a semi-shaded area to slowly grow, and do not let strong light shine directly on it. |
